About the role:
- Provide technical guidance for all blasting activities on site
- Liaise with Area Supervisors to produce timely drill and blast designs.
- Develop and maintain plans, designs and blast packs for all shots.
- Provide direction to Operations re shot locations, timing and blasting requirements.
- Issue drill pattern preparation plans, liaising with Production Supervisors to allow sufficient preparation ensuring drill operations have limited downtime.
- Record shots, results, and complete blast reconciliations for all blasts on site.
- Ensure blast design meets regulatory compliance (vibration, noise)
- Support Drill & Blast Crew on effective blasting and drilling techniques.
- Maintain effective relationships with internal and external stakeholders.
- Participate in incident investigation.
